Abstract:

The ability of the public health system to meet current and projected needs is being seriously compromised by a growing shortage of nurses, an expanded, post-September 11 public health mandate, and economic constraints at the local, state, and federal levels.

This brief highlights nursing's unique contributions to assuring the public's health and vital importance in both prevention and emergency preparedness. It considers several workforce initiatives; profiles programs that attribute their success to nurse involvement; and presents promising state and federal policies.
